Method 1: Using a VPN
One of the simplest ways to change your apparent geolocation is by using a Virtual Private Network (VPN). A VPN can mask your IP address and make it appear as if you are located in another country. However, it's essential to understand that while a VPN can hide your IP address, it does not alter the GPS location reported by your iPhone.
- Choose a Reputable VPN Service: Select a VPN provider that offers servers in various locations.
- Install the VPN App: Download and install the VPN app from the App Store.
- Connect to a Server: Open the VPN app and connect to a server in your desired location.
- Open WhatsApp: Your IP address will now appear as if it is coming from the selected VPN server location, but remember this does not change your GPS coordinates reported by your iPhone.

Important Considerations
- Terms of Service: Changing your geolocation using methods other than those officially supported by WhatsApp may violate their terms of service.
- Security Risks: Using third-party apps or VPNs can introduce security risks, including potential data breaches or malware infections.
- Accuracy Limitations: Even with these methods, the accuracy of your spoofed location may vary, and it might not be foolproof.
